Answer to Question 2

Elders may offer financial support to their caregivers who then take advantage of
them. Caregivers may initially be equipped to assist the elder but escalating frailty
frustrates them resulting in unmet needs. Resentment may build as family members
are called upon to care for someone who may no longer recognize them. Common
forms of elder abuse include spending the elder's assets, over-medicating the elder,
and using restraints. Abuse may escalate to more clear-cut physical abuse. Ways to
prevent elder abuse include providing support for caregivers such as respite care,
realizing that caring for an ill or frail elder in the home may be unwise, and providing
more safety nets in the community for elders and their caregivers.

For about 100 years, scientists thought that peptic ulcers were caused by stress, spicy food, and alcohol. Later, researchers added stomach acid to the list of causes and began treating ulcers with antacids. Now it is known that peptic ulcers are predominantly caused by Helicobacter pylori, a spiral-shaped bacterium that normally exist in the stomach.

Nearly all drugs pass into human breast milk. How often a drug is taken influences the amount of drug that will pass into the milk. Medications taken 30 to 60 minutes before breastfeeding are likely to be at peak blood levels when the baby is nursing.
